Ok, so our door hasn't been working lately. (It's the door that's inside the garage: not the garage door, but the door to the house IN the garage.) If you try to close it, 99% of the time it'll not close entirely because the little part that sticks out when you lock it gets in the way, so you have to turn the knob all the way until it's fully closed. We were planning on fixing it soon...
But today, Mom didn't lock the door before we left to eat dinner (today's my dad's birthday). And when we came home, it WAS locked. My dad tried to unlock it several times, and even after we all tried to force it open, it didn't work. The sane thing to do would have been to call a locksmith to open it for us, but that costs money, and we'd just spent a whole bunch of money on the awesome Japanese restaurant we went to.
Our only solution was to break into our own house.
The only window that was reachable and possibly open was mine. We got the ladder and tried to climb up, but the ladder (my first thought was the whole ladder-stepladder thing in Phoenix Wright) was too short and too wobbly. So I had to go next door to borrow our neighbors' ladder. "Hi, would it be okay if we borrowed your ladder for a bit?"
Our neighbor was kind enough to help us set up the ladder, get my dad on the roof (I couldn't go, I was wearing a skirt and shoes that would've made me slip off and die), and open my window. It was closed, but luckily, it was unlocked, so all Dad had to do was take off the screen and open my window to get in and unlock the front door to let the rest of us in. I got to get on the roof afterwards, to pick up the screen, because it was still on the roof~! Needless to say, we're gonna get a new doorknob.
All in all, it was a very memorable birthday for my dad, and a fun anecdote for me to share with you all. >w<
